Pascal-Alexis Devèze
Devèze was an aero inventor, addressed at 45, rue Saint-Sébastien, Paris, Seine; France.[1] A multi-chapter publication, inclusive of math, as well as theory, is co-bound within the patent document.
He seems to have been an early proponent of HTA. This is indicated both via his patent filed and the subject matter of his writing. Devèze, 1867, Du vol ou de la navigation aérienne. Étude d'un appareil d'aviation ou navigation aérienne sans ballons gives M. Devèze.
